Transaction 2586b21069aaf5e2b66788e3b63be1fade2ae62f5d1f588aeadf49e986c191bd

block
03dcd6c44694d7538f19824351965662cc3b89a1d7249e8ba0681fd4fc0cacf0

1 Input

3 Outputs